Output fae6bfbc3dcc8a229e67d18571cea3a0e68890e57d90dd863bd5afcb80e586b9:41

value
352514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e6540f709084bcdd1eede92844cac155f3e517d OP_EQUAL
address
3318gTuE98iUezKvHyPbVjqtoibBo8HdJf
transaction
fae6bfbc3dcc8a229e67d18571cea3a0e68890e57d90dd863bd5afcb80e586b9
spent
true